Leadership skills only apply when
1. You are in a fleet/wing/squadron 2. The booster of said fleet/wing/squadron is in the same system 3. and undocked
Running solo will not grant you any bonus from the leadership skills...

Edited by: Twarda Sztuka on 11/08/2008 10:50:54 Lets assume that you have two accounts. Account A have nice bonuses from Leadership category. Account B is skilling to be a trader somewhere else. Log into two accounts. Invite account B to the fleet. Make account A a sqadron booster. Now the bonuses should affect account A when it is not docked. The purpose of account B is only to make a fleet (you can't make it with just one character).
Now with skills at level V you get 10% bonuses to armor, shields, speed and targeting speed. If you put a correct mindlink in your head you get 15% for one of those. If you have command ship with warfare links it gets even better.

Doesn't work. In order to get the bonuses, 3 conditions have to be met: 1: Squad commander has to be undocked in the system 2: Squad booster has to be undocked in the system 3: Atleast 1 squad member has to be undocked in the system Your suggestion fail point 3. If that trader is just skilling, you can have him afk in a safespot in space in the system you're running missions in though.
